Common GE Problems We Fix

Cooling and defrost issues on GE refrigerators
Washer fill and drain problems on GE laundry units
Dryers not heating or shutting off early
Dishwashers not cleaning or leaving standing water
Oven sensor and control issues that affect baking performance
Error-code diagnosis for GE refrigeration and laundry products

Many of these symptoms start small and then become more disruptive over time. A refrigerator that runs constantly can turn into food loss, a washer that drains slowly can become a full no-drain failure, and an oven with inconsistent heat can make everyday cooking unpredictable. Early service usually reduces both downtime and repeat failures.
